Arsenal: Arteta secures homegrown players at the club

It appears that Arsenal will have a busy summer of transfer ins and outs as Mikel Arteta attempts to resurrect his team’s competitiveness. This summer, Arsenal has already signed Nuno Tavares and Albert Sambi Lokonga. The Gunners are rumored to be interested in signing Tammy Abraham, Ben White, James Maddison, Aaron Ramsdale, and others. Granit Xhaka, Hector Bellerin, Alexandre Lacazette, and Eddie Nketiah are all expected to depart the club in the near future. After Aston Villa expressed interest, Emile Smith Rowe has pledged his future to the club until 2026.

It means Arteta can now construct his team around two great young players, 20-year-old Smith Rowe and 19-year-old Bukayo Saka, for the long haul. Saka signed a new four-year deal in July of last year and went on to have a fantastic season, so Arsenal will be hoping for a similar boost for Smith Rowe to continue his upward trend.

Kieran Tierney has been re-signed by the Gunners on a fresh contract until 2026. Arsenal will be revitalized with young talent at hand. Arsenal’s homegrown stars Smith Rowe and Saka will be pivotal in their efforts.

Smith Rowe, who turns 21 on Wednesday, will now have to take the next step in his career. It was a wonderful symbolic touch to hand him the No 10 shirt, following in the footsteps of Paul Merson, Dennis Bergkamp, Robin van Persie, Jack Wilshere, and Mesut Ozil, but it also came with responsibilities. Now he’ll have to equal that role’s performance, as well as the quantity of goals and assists. Smith Rowe only had four goals and seven assists last season, but he has already been set a goal.

Smith Rowe and Arsenal are expected to improve significantly with the appropriate arrivals to enhance the club, as well as the absence of Europa League action every midweek.
